数据有效性还在做下拉框就out了,五种技巧用法,操作简单又高效

发布时间:2024-09-19

Image

在Excel中, 数据有效性功能通常被用来创建简单的下拉菜单 ,限制用户输入特定范围的值。然而,这个功能的潜力远不止于此。让我们探索五种创新的、非传统的数据有效性用法,这些方法不仅能提高数据输入的准确性,还能简化复杂的数据处理流程。

一、动态下拉菜单

传统的下拉菜单是静态的,一旦设置就无法更改。但通过结合使用数据有效性与公式,我们可以创建动态下拉菜单,根据用户的输入自动调整选项。

例如,我们可以创建一个根据省份选择自动更新的城市下拉菜单。首先,在一个辅助列中列出所有可能的城市选项。然后,在数据有效性设置中使用INDIRECT函数,将序列来源设置为“=INDIRECT(A1)”,其中A1是省份选择单元格。这样,当用户选择省份时,城市下拉菜单会自动更新为该省份对应的城市列表。

二、条件性数据输入

数据有效性不仅可以限制输入的范围,还可以根据特定条件允许或禁止某些输入 。例如,我们可以设置一个公式,只允许输入唯一的发票编号。

在数据有效性设置中选择“自定义”,然后输入公式“=COUNTIF($A$1:A1,A1)<=1”。这个公式检查当前单元格的值在整个列中是否只出现一次。如果出现多次,系统会阻止输入并显示错误信息。

三、多级数据联动

对于复杂的多级数据结构,我们可以使用数据有效性创建联动的下拉菜单。例如, 创建一个国家-省份-城市的选择结构

首先,为每一级创建一个下拉菜单。然后,在较低级别的数据有效性设置中使用INDIRECT函数,将序列来源设置为对上一级选择的引用。这样,当用户在上一级做出选择时,下一级的选项会自动更新。

四、智能数据验证

数据有效性不仅可以用于限制输入,还可以提供智能的输入提示和错误警告。例如,我们可以设置一个日期输入字段, 当用户输入错误格式的日期时,系统会自动提示正确的格式

在数据有效性设置中选择“日期”,然后设置允许的日期范围。在“输入信息”选项卡中,输入提示信息,如“请输入格式为YYYY-MM-DD的日期”。在“出错警告”选项卡中,设置错误信息,如“输入的日期格式不正确,请重新输入”。

五、数据分级显示

数据有效性还可以用于创建分级显示的数据结构 ,使大量数据更加易于管理和查看。

首先,将数据按照层级关系整理好。然后,在数据选项卡中选择“组合”>“自动建立分级显示”。这将自动为数据添加分级显示的功能,用户可以通过点击加减号来展开或折叠数据层级。

这些创新的用法展示了数据有效性功能的强大潜力。通过结合使用公式、函数和其他Excel功能,我们可以将简单的数据有效性转变为强大的数据管理工具。这些技巧不仅能提高数据输入的准确性,还能简化复杂的数据处理流程,大大提高工作效率。